Buying Guide for the Best Cd Bluetooth Players

When choosing a CD Bluetooth player, it's important to consider several key specifications to ensure you get the best fit for your needs. These devices combine the classic functionality of a CD player with the modern convenience of Bluetooth connectivity, allowing you to enjoy your music collection in various ways. Here are the key specs to look out for and how to navigate them.
Bluetooth VersionBluetooth version determines the quality and range of the wireless connection. Newer versions, like Bluetooth 5.0, offer better range, faster data transfer, and improved audio quality compared to older versions like Bluetooth 4.0. If you plan to use the player with modern Bluetooth devices and want the best performance, opt for a player with the latest Bluetooth version available.
Audio Formats SupportedThis spec indicates the types of audio files the CD Bluetooth player can read and play. Common formats include MP3, WMA, and AAC. If you have a diverse music collection, ensure the player supports multiple formats to avoid compatibility issues. For high-quality audio, look for support for lossless formats like FLAC.
Battery LifeBattery life is crucial if you plan to use the CD Bluetooth player on the go. It indicates how long the player can operate on a single charge. Players with longer battery life are more convenient for travel and outdoor use. Consider your usage patterns; if you need the player for long trips, choose one with extended battery life.
PortabilityPortability refers to the size and weight of the CD Bluetooth player. If you need a player that you can easily carry around, look for a compact and lightweight model. For home use, portability might be less of a concern, and you can opt for a larger player with more features.
Sound QualitySound quality is determined by the player's internal components, such as the digital-to-analog converter (DAC) and the quality of the built-in speakers. Higher-end models often provide better sound clarity and depth. If you are an audiophile or simply want the best listening experience, prioritize sound quality and look for reviews or specifications that highlight superior audio performance.
Connectivity OptionsBesides Bluetooth, check for other connectivity options like AUX input, USB ports, and headphone jacks. These additional options can enhance the versatility of the player, allowing you to connect it to various devices and external speakers. Consider your existing audio setup and how you plan to use the player to determine which connectivity options are essential for you.
Ease of UseEase of use includes the user interface, controls, and any additional features like remote control or app compatibility. A player with intuitive controls and a clear display can make your listening experience more enjoyable. If you prefer convenience, look for models with user-friendly features and positive reviews regarding their ease of use.
